Hi,
at first before you look at your hardware, you should look at Rimworld itself.
Enable Developer Mode at the Options.
The top left icon open the log window.
Check if you got errors, special repeating errors slow down the game performance.
If you got errors, check the log window after your started Rimworld before you load a safegame.
Do you have error's after the Rimworld start ?
When you got error, that's bad try to adjust your modlist so you got no errors.
Mosttimes disabling all mods and slowly activate them at small batches with 5-10 mods are the best way.

Once you know what mods cause the problems, look for updates, check the mod discussion, ask the mod author.

Ok,
since you use an older GPU, when did you update the driver the last time ?
That maybe could increase the performace a bit too.

About the game, what map size do you use ?
Normaly below 12 pawns and around 30 animals shouldn't be a problem.
But when you play on large or xlarge maps the performace can drop dramatic.
Same for animals, if you got 100+ animals, special when anymal need to look for food, the performace can drop too.
